下面将详细解释如何为线下服务器安装Agent,该过程涉及数个关键步骤和操作细节,需要仔细遵循以确保正确安装和配置。
前提条件检查
确保满足以下条件:
系统要求:确认服务器操作系统与Agent兼容,Agent支持的Linux操作系统版本请参见官方文档。
网络配置:确认服务器的网络设置正确,包括DNS配置和安全组规则,以避免因网络问题导致Agent下载失败。
下载与上传Agent安装包
1、获取Agent安装包:首先从数据库审计系统或相关官方网站下载Agent的安装包,确保选择与您的服务器操作系统相匹配的版本。
2、上传至服务器:使用如WinSCP等文件传输工具,将下载的Agent安装包上传到指定服务器的目录中。
安装Agent
1、进入安装包目录:通过SSH方式登录到服务器,使用cd
命令进入含有Agent安装包的目录。
在Linux系统中,可以使用命令:cd /path/to/your/agent
。
2、解压缩安装包:根据安装包的类型(如.tar.gz
),使用相应的解压命令解压文件,在Linux系统中,可以使用tar xvf agent_package.tar.gz
命令。
3、执行安装脚本:进入解压后的目录,执行安装脚本,在Linux系统中,通常需要运行install.sh
脚本,具体命令为bash install.sh
或sh install.sh
,注意,可能需要为安装脚本添加执行权限。
对于Ubuntu系统,可以使用命令chmod +x install.sh
添加执行权限,然后执行安装脚本。
4、设置Agent用户密码:在首次安装时,系统可能会提示您设置DBSS用户的密码,该用户用于运行Agent程序。
验证Agent安装与运行状态
1、查看安装结果:Agent安装完成后,系统会显示相应的成功信息,在Linux系统中,您可能看到类似“start succeed”的信息,表明Agent已成功启动。
2、检查Agent状态:可以通过查看Agent服务的状态来确认其是否正在运行,在Linux系统中,可以使用service audit_agent status
命令查看Agent的运行状态。
后续配置与管理
1、配置Agent:安装后,可能需要根据具体需求进行额外的配置,例如设置审计规则或调整日志保存参数,这可以通过编辑Agent的配置文件或使用相关的管理工具来完成。
2、管理Agent:常见操作包括启用、停用、卸载Agent,这些操作可以通过在Agent的安装目录下运行相应的脚本来完成,如dbagent_start.sh
、dbagent_stop.sh
和uninstall.sh
。
为了确保过程中的顺利进行和最终的成功,还需要注意以下要点:
确保在每一步操作中都跟随正确的指导,特别是在处理文件和目录权限时。
若在安装过程中遇到任何问题,可以查阅官方文档或寻求技术支持。
按需定期更新Agent软件,以确保安全性和功能的持续性。
为线下服务器安装Agent是一个涉及多个步骤的过程,需要耐心和细心地按照指南操作,确保在安装前准备好所有必要的条件,并在安装过程中密切关注命令执行的结果,安装后,通过持续的管理和监控确保Agent能够有效运行,为您的网络安全提供坚实的保障。
以下是关于“服务器安装步骤五:为线下服务器安装Agent”的介绍:
序号 | 操作步骤 | 说明/备注 |
1 | 准备工作 | 确保以下条件满足:服务器可以访问互联网,获取Agent安装包,拥有管理员权限。 |
2 | 下载Agent安装包 | 访问指定官网或存储服务器,下载适用于您服务器操作系统的Agent安装包。 |
3 | 上传安装包到服务器 | 使用FTP、SCP等工具,将下载好的Agent安装包上传到目标服务器。 |
4 | 解压安装包 | 在服务器上找到安装包所在路径,使用命令行或图形界面解压安装包。tar zxf agent.tar.gz (Linux) |
5 | 停止相关服务(可选) | 如果服务器已安装其他监控或管理工具,建议先停止相关服务,避免冲突。 |
6 | 安装Agent | 根据操作系统的不同,执行相应的安装命令。sudo ./install.sh (Linux)或者双击安装程序(Windows) |
7 | 配置Agent | 根据实际需求修改Agent配置文件,如:配置服务器地址、端口、密钥等。 |
8 | 启动Agent服务 | 根据安装说明启动Agent服务,确保Agent正常运行。sudo systemctl start agent (Linux) |
9 | 检查Agent状态 | 检查Agent是否已成功运行,可以通过查看日志或使用命令行工具检查服务状态。 |
10 | 设置开机自启(可选) | 为了确保服务器重启后Agent能够自动运行,可以设置开机自启。sudo systemctl enable agent (Linux) |
11 | 测试验证 | 通过发送测试请求,验证Agent是否可以正常收集数据并上传至监控平台。 |
12 | 记录安装信息 | 将安装过程、配置信息以及可能遇到的问题和解决方案记录下来,方便后续运维管理。 |
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/716430.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复